Removal and Deportation Defense in Pratts, VA: What to Expect
In Virginia, the deportation process is initiated when you receive a Notice to Appear (NTA) before the immigration court. In your notice, you will be given the U.S. government's argument for starting removal proceedings against you and the legal reasons behind your removal.
Next, you will have an immigration court hearing scheduled. It is crucial to attend this hearing: should you fail to attend your hearing in immigration court you may face a deportation order issued in your absence. At your initial immigration court hearing, you will have both the charges being brought against you and your rights explained by the judge. At this initial hearing, you will have the opportunity to present your defense, which may include filing for relief such as asylum, cancellation of removal, or adjustment of status. Evidence and documentation supporting the relief must be gathered and submitted. Your immigration judge will examine your case, take testimony from witnesses, and render a decision. Should you receive a negative ruling, you may appeal to the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A).
